A small rock is thrown vertically upward with a speed of 17.0 meter per second from the edge of the roof of a 26 meter tall building. The rock doesn't hit the building on its way back down and lands in the street below. Air resistance can be ignored.
Part A Determine the speed of the rock just before it hits the street?
Part B Determine how much time elapses from when the rock is thrown until it hits the street?
